Borderline Personality Disorder (BPD) is a complex and often misunderstood condition, characterized by emotional instability, impulsive behaviors, and significant challenges in interpersonal relationships. These emotional fluctuations can leave you feeling in a constant state of dysregulation, affecting your thoughts, moods, and behaviors. My approach to working with BPD is informed by Internal Family Systems (IFS), where we explore the different emotional parts that emerge in order to better understand their origins and purposes. Given the complexity and stigma surrounding BPD, it's essential to explore the underlying factors contributing to your experience, including early childhood relationships and current relational patterns. Together, we will work toward gradually rebuilding your sense of self and addressing any confusion about your view of self and your view of others. Borderline Personality Disorder therapists in Orillia, Ontario, Canada Statistics

Borderline Personality Disorder therapists in Orillia, Ontario, Canada average 10 years of experience and charge around $174 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(81%),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) (70%), and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(70%).
